概括
这项研究揭示了集体内体富勒烯 (Na20@C240) 中的电子相互作用如何增强光电离. 这涉及电子转移和共振衰变过程,显著提高了电离产量.

主要成果:
- 观察到的电子合导致潜在的变化,电子转移和杂交.
- 由于C240.0,对Na20类型水平的光离子化截面显著增强,这是由于C240.
- 在C240中的光激发等离子体通过共振集群间库伦比衰变 (ICD) 衰变到Na20的电离连续体中.
- 由于ICD和SAMO诱导的奥格尔衰变,Na20电离产量的显著增强.

Spin systems where the difference in chemical shifts of the coupled nuclei is greater than ten times J are called first-order spin systems. These nuclei are weakly coupled, and their chemical shifts and coupling constant can generally be estimated from the well-separated signals in the spectrum.
As Δν decreases and the signals move closer, the doublets appear increasingly distorted. The intensities of the inner lines increase at the cost of those of the outer lines as the signals are...

According to valence bond theory, a covalent bond results when: (1) an orbital on one atom overlaps an orbital on a second atom, and (2) the single electrons in each orbital combine to form an electron pair. The strength of a covalent bond depends on the extent of overlap of the orbitals involved. Maximum overlap is possible when the orbitals overlap on a direct line between the two nuclei.
